Abstract

Quantitative research requires accurate statistical analysis to ensure that the results obtained are valid and scientifically accountable. One important stage in statistical analysis is assumption testing, particularly normality and homogeneity tests, which are prerequisites for the use of parametric statistical methods. This article aims to discuss the concepts, roles, and applications of normality and homogeneity tests in statistical analysis. The research method used is qualitative research with a li brary research approach through the study of statistical textbooks and relevant national and international journal articles. The results of the discussion show that the normality test plays a role in ensuring that the data distribution approximates a normal distribution, while the homogeneity test is used to ensure the uniformity of variance between data groups. Fulfilling these two assumptions allows researchers to use parametric statistical techniques appropriately and reduce the risk of bias in the analysis. Thus, a good understanding of normality and homogeneity tests is very important to improve the quality of data analysis and the accuracy of research conclusions.
